Hi guys!
Is it possible to set up a wireless broadband router for use on NTL? On the router itself, the 'Internet' port is a normal modem port (like a small RJ45 jack) but with NTL, it is a RJ45 cable (ethernet) that goes directly from the PC NIC into the wall socket (RJ45 on both ends)
I think what I need is a RJ45 to (i think) RJ11 (same shape but smaller than RJ45) cable. Am I right in assuming this and if so, where would I get one from?
Many thanks in advance guys!!

M@rt1n_P
 
Yes it is possible, i have one at uni. Best place for cables is ebay-you can get anything on there! Dont foget you need a DSL router for cable broadband, NOT ADSL. I got mine from eBuyer, their value model for about £22.

Unsure, having never dealt with Dabs before, it doesnt hurt to try. When you do get setup make sure you check for driver updates and that you protect yourself. Use a good firewall (i use Kerio) and that you enable 128bit incription and even limited MAC address authentification. All this means that only you and those who you want to use the connection can. Otherwise you will find next door (and possibly the rest of your street) using your connection/monthly allowance! ;) Be warned!
With a bit of googling you can find out all you need to know about the above security features...
